Buhari reappoints Abubakar, Asein as Legal Aid Council, Copyright Commission DGs

President Muhammadu Buhari has renewed the tenures of two federal officials, Aliyu Abubakar and John Asein.

Abubakar and Asein are Directors General of the Legal Aid Council of Nigeria (LACON) and the Nigerian Copyright Commission, respectively.

Modupe Ogundoro, Director of Public Relations in the Justice Ministry announced their re-engagement on Sunday.

The letter to Abubakar vide Ref: PRES/97/HAGF/174 is dated January 12, 2023.

The appointment is in line with Section 3 (1) and (2) of the Legal Aid Act, CAP. L9.

Asein’s letter, which confirms his final four-year term vide Ref: PRES/97/HAGF/175, is also dated January 12.

Section 36 (1) and (2) of the Nigerian Copyright Commission Act, CAP C28 backs the appointment.

Buhari also approved the nomination of Abiodun Aikomo as Secretary of the Administration of Criminal Justice Monitoring Committee (ACJMC).

Aikomo’s letter vide Ref: PRES/97/HAGF/173 says his tenure is for an initial period of four years.

His designation is in line with Section 471 (2) of the Administration of Criminal Justice Act (ACJA) 2015.

The re-appointment of Abubakar and Asein took effect January 12, while that of Aikomo was effective January 16.
